    > Although guarded methods seem necessary, unfortunately, I don’t know of any mainstream languages that allow their definition.

    C++ has this feature. When you define a template class, you can use SFINAE (or, in modern C++, concepts) to make it so that certain methods only exist if the template parameter meets certain requirements.

    (Though even this is often unnecessary - for something like your `flatten` example, you could just go ahead and define it unrestricted. Methods of template classes are typechecked lazily - in other words, they don't need to successfully typecheck unless they're called. For this specific use case, SFINAE/concepts would just make the error message nicer.)

    Rust also has this feature, with conditional impls.

    I'm building a new language and just a couple of days ago the concept of guard methods came up as I was trying to tighten up equality semantics to be more like Swift.

    Things like Array.contains() only work if the element type implements the Equatable interface, so it would be a guard method. Maybe something like:

        class Array<T> {
          contains(value: T): boolean where T extends Equatable { ... }
        }
    
    Or possibly a constraint on the `this` type, TypeScript style:

        class Array<T> {
          contains(this: Array<T extends Equatable>, value: T): boolean { ... }
        }
